Wonky and a bit (46km)
Click for an exciting animated video.
Distance: 46km
Elevation gained: 306m
Start this ride early to make the most of quieter roads and to allow plenty of time to visit attractions including the Arch, London Bridge, the Grotto, Bay of Islands, Bay of Martyrs and Boat Bay. This variation of the Wonky Stingray takes the rider onto quieter roads towards the end of the ride and has a few nice undulations before the descent into Port Campbell
The Hill - Princetown - Lavers Hill - Princetown 65km
Click for an exciting animated video.
Distance: 64.9km
Elevation gained: 993m
A wonderful little coastal to forest hill climb of 65km with a little under 1000m of vertical. Best completed in the morning before 11.00am or surprisingly at night when the road carries very little traffic.

Princetown - Fords Road: Time trial loop 24.5km
Click for an exciting animated video.
Distance: 24.5km
Elevation gained: 346m
Steady undulating climbs through lush farmland and native bushland for the first 12km sets you up for a steady descent with ocean views before rejoining the Great Ocean Road 4km west of Princetown. Check out this short video for all the details.
Camperdown to Timboon Rail Trail
The completed 34km Camperdown to Timboon trail is a wonderful family adventure, dotted with statuesque trestle bridges and spellbinding scenery.
